As some of you may have seen on my Instagram, I’ve been living in these oversized blanket scarves this winter! I actually shied away from the big square size for a long time thinking it’d overwhelm my frame, but after experiencing how warm they are against the elements I’m not turning back! They’ve been a key part of my daily commute, and also conveniently serve as a shawl for when the office AC is blasting. Through playing around and trial and error, I’ve learned a few favorite favorite ways to style a blanket scarf.

All of the styles I’m sharing today start with a square scarf folded in half into a triangle, but you can easily adapt for other shapes as well. A few readers mentioned that to cut down on the volume, they actually took scissors to their scarves and cut the square into two triangles. I personally wouldn’t do this because I like the volume for warmth (and also the raw cut edge might unravel), but just wanted to pass along this idea…
